First pedal- zoom ms50 or ms70

Looking for reverb for my first pedal in a simple volca setup.

I keep seeing the zoom pedals mentioned. It would be cool to have a variety of effects. I was looking at cheap reverb stuff (like £30) but figured May as well spend more for something decent.

Both the ms50 and ms70 are the same price at Andertons, £105.

I see the MS50 specifically says ‘for guitar’, and the ms70 is stereo (not bothered about that). Would the Ms50 sound worse, being designed for a guitar as the input?

Which way should I go? There are so few second hand on eBay. The ones that are there look a bit shabby.
